ABSTRACT
The GNU Compiler Collection is one of the most widely used C and C++ compilers. It has been under active development for over twenty years. This talk will be a discussion of major topics in overall GCC development, covering the efforts going on today, the plans for the future, and how Google's GCC team is helping. Credits: Speaker:Ian Lance Taylor
